Grassroots Labor Organizing in the South
This chapter explores grassroots strategies for identifying and empowering leaders in marginalized communities, particularly through the lens of the Tennessee Drivers Union. By examining the unionization of gig workers and the complexities of labor recognition, the discussion highlights significant actions taken by drivers and the broader implications for labor rights. It critiques political approaches within the Democratic Party and advocates for a more inclusive and grassroots-oriented labor movement in the Southern United States.
